Handover for the Textport upload service. Main gotcha: encoding detection falls back to Latin-1 when confidence drops below the threshold, which mangles some Nordic uploads. Miral was tuning the detector weights before she rotated off; don't touch them without rerunning the corpus tests. The detector reads its runtime settings from the block below.

deployment values, yadug-bawif:
[framir]
team = pelox
access_code = ac_a38ab2
owner = tamion.julael
host = framir.tolvaqlabs.test
port = 11211
peer = tammir.zemvargrid.local
salt = 2215ef03
pin = 1541

## Changelog — v2.8.1

Renamed setting: PRICEX_AB_KEY is now PRICEX_EXPERIMENT_SECRET, used by the Tollgren ticket-pricing experiment service to sign variant-assignment payloads. The old name is deprecated and will stop being read in v2.9.0. Rotation was performed at rename time, so old values are invalid. Update your env file by removing the old entry and appending the new assignment immediately after this note:

secret setting of kaguf-bawif: ARCHIVE_KEY3=ebb

This alert fires when the nightly ColdVault job that archives cold storage buckets has not completed within its 6-hour window. The job moves buckets flagged inactive for 180 days into glacier-tier storage and writes a manifest per bucket. Common causes: manifest write contention, oversized buckets exceeding the chunking limit, or a stuck lease on the archival queue. Reviewers touching the archiver should confirm the lease-renewal patch is included before merging. If the alert persists after one retry cycle, notify the storage platform team.

billing contact of tahaf-kafop = istwyn_fraox@norvaworks.corp